EDITORS COMMENTS
A Group of Young Men Playing Cricket, by John Hassall This photograph, taken by the renowned English artist John Hassall, transports us back in time to a quintessential English village scene. The image captures a moment of pure joy and camaraderie as a group of young men engage in a spirited game of cricket. The sun casts a warm glow over the scene, illuminating the lush, green grass and the vibrant colors of the players' clothing. The historical significance of this photograph lies in its ability to encapsulate the essence of cricket as a cherished pastime in the United Kingdom. Cricket has a rich history that dates back to the 16th century, and by the late 19th and early 20th centuries, it had become a national obsession. This photograph is a testament to the enduring popularity of the sport and the role it played in bringing communities together. The young cricketers in the photograph are deeply focused on the game, their expressions reflecting a mix of determination, concentration, and excitement. Their youthful energy and enthusiasm are palpable, making this image a delightful reminder of the simple pleasures of rural life and the joy of playing a game with friends. John Hassall's exceptional artistic skills are evident in the way he has captured the dynamic interplay of light and shadow, as well as the intricate details of the players' clothing and equipment. This photograph is not only a beautiful work of art but also a valuable historical document that offers a glimpse into the past and the enduring appeal of cricket as a cherished British tradition.
